Label check out test set with paste mark head
Technical Field
The utility model relates to the technical field of detection equipment, in particular to label detection equipment with a label sticking head.
Background
In order to improve production efficiency and reduce labor cost, an automatic labeling machine is generally adopted to label a packing box of materials, and label detection equipment is needed to detect whether the label on the packing box is in place or not after the label is labeled.
In the working process of the detection equipment, if the condition that the label on the packing box is unreasonable to be pasted is detected, the packing box is generally manually removed, the unreasonable label is pasted on the packing box for re-labeling, the process is time-consuming and labor-consuming, the production efficiency is greatly reduced, and the efficient production is not facilitated.

Detailed Description
The present utility model will now be described in detail with reference to the accompanying drawings. The figure is a simplified schematic diagram illustrating the basic structure of the utility model only by way of illustration, and therefore it shows only the constitution related to the utility model.
Referring to fig. 1 to 4, a label detection apparatus with a label attaching head, a detection mechanism 30 includes a feeding mechanism 10, a limit assembly 20 and a detection mechanism 30, in this embodiment, a packaging box is sent to the limit assembly 20 by the feeding mechanism 10, and after the position of the packaging box is limited and fixed by the limit assembly 20, a label on the packaging box is detected by the detection mechanism 30.
The detection mechanism 30 comprises a detection table 31 and a sliding table 32 arranged on the detection table 31, a sliding plate 33 is connected to the sliding table 32 in a sliding manner, a supporting frame 34 arranged along the length direction of the sliding plate 33 is arranged at the top end of the sliding plate 33, a plurality of transverse guide rails 35 are arranged at intervals at one end of the supporting frame 34, a first sliding block 36 is connected to the transverse guide rails 35 in a sliding manner, and a fixing piece 37 is connected to one end, away from the transverse guide rails 35, of the first sliding block 36.
The other end of the fixing piece 37 is connected with a vertical guide rail 38, a sliding block two 39 is movably connected to the vertical guide rail 38, a first cylinder 391 is arranged at the top end of the vertical guide rail 38, a first telescopic rod 392 is connected to the bottom end of the first cylinder 391, and in this embodiment, the first telescopic rod 392 is connected with the sliding block two 39.
One end of the second slider 39 is connected with a mounting plate 393, a second cylinder 394 is mounted at one end of the mounting plate 393 away from the second slider 39, a second telescopic rod 395 is connected to the other end of the second cylinder 394, further, a movable plate 396 is connected to the other end of the mounting plate 393, the second telescopic rod 395 penetrates through the movable plate 396, and a mobile station 397 is connected to the other end of the second telescopic rod 395.
The top of fly leaf 396 is installed the installed part 398, and the top of installed part 398 is provided with support 399, installs motor 400 on the support 399, and the one end of motor 400 is connected with pivot 401, is provided with gear 402 on this pivot 401, and further, is provided with movable part 403 in the one end that movable platform 397 kept away from telescopic link two 395, and in this embodiment, movable part 403 is the arc setting.
A first connecting member 405 is disposed between the top end of the movable member 403 and the mounting member 398, a groove 406 is formed in the mobile station 397, the bottom end of the movable member 403 is located in the groove 406, and a second connecting member 407 is disposed between the bottom end of the movable member 403 and the groove 406, in this embodiment, the two ends of the movable member 403 are fixed by the first connecting member 405 and the second connecting member 407, so as to ensure that the movable member 403 cannot be separated in the moving process.
One end of the movable member 403 is also provided with a rack 404 which meshes with the gear 402.
The movable member 403 is further provided with a first fixed plate 408 on a side facing away from the mobile station 397, a detection head 409 is provided on the first fixed plate 408, a second fixed plate 410 is provided on the movable member 403, and a label head 411 is provided on the second fixed plate 410, in this embodiment, the first fixed plate 408 is disposed at 90 ° with the second fixed plate 410.
The working principle of the utility model is as follows:
In the process of detecting the sticking condition of the label on the packaging box, firstly, the sliding plate 33 slides on the sliding table 32 to determine the distance relation between the detection mechanism 30 and the packaging box, then, the sliding plate 36 slides on the transverse guide rail 35 to determine the displacement of the detection head 409 in the left-right direction, the first telescopic rod 392 is driven to move by the first cylinder 391, the second sliding plate 39 connected with the first telescopic rod 392 is driven to move by the first telescopic rod 392, the second sliding plate 39 slides on the vertical guide rail 38 to determine the lifting displacement of the detection head 409, and the label sticking condition on the packaging box is checked by the detection head 409.
If the label on the packing box has the problems of missing adhesion, pasting skew and the like, the motor 400 is started, the motor 400 drives the rotating shaft 401 to move, the gear 402 connected with the motor 400 is driven to move through the rotating shaft 401, the gear 402 further drives the rack 404 connected with the gear 402 to move, the movable piece 403 connected with the gear 402 is driven to move, the movable piece 403 moves 90 degrees, the detection head 409 is switched into the label pasting head 411, then the air cylinder II 394 is started, the air cylinder II 394 drives the telescopic rod II 395 connected with the air cylinder II to move, the moving table 397 connected with the telescopic rod II 395 is driven to move, the label pasting head 411 is indirectly driven to move, and the packing box is re-labeled through the label pasting head 411.
After the labeling is completed, the motor 400 is started again, the movable piece 403 is indirectly driven to move through the motor 400, the labeling head 411 is converted into the detection head 409, and the packaging box is processed again.
